# Parliament’s Standing Committee on Appropriations is calling for urgent steps and political will to ensure adequate funding for the Border Management Authority. According to the Department of Home Affairs, the BMA’s approved organisational structure provides for 11-thousand-115 personnel. However, only two-thousand-566 positions have been filled. # Construction giant Murray and Roberts Holdings has been placed under provisional liquidation following a court order. The Gauteng High Court granted the order at the behest of one of the company’s creditors.
